Jason Kirk
Jason Kirk is a writer from Nashville, Tennessee.
In 2005 he quit his job and covered the full duration of the first WSOP Circuit ever held in Tunica, Miss. - for his own poker blog. That led to a successful tournament reporting gig for a major poker magazine, which in turn led to radio and video production gigs at the WSOP in 2006 and 2007. This January he joined the team at PokerListings.com, where he writes about poker and politics and interviews some of the biggest names in the game.
In his three years in the industry, Jason has served as a reporter and photographer at most of the major poker tournaments in North America outside the WSOP, including the WPT Championship, NBC National Heads-Up Championship, Festa al Lago, LA Poker Classic, World Poker Finals, and Borgata Poker Open.
Jason holds a B.A. in History from Austin Peay State University. He lives with his wife of four years and two dogs.
